What is Biomedical Waste?
Biomedical waste, also known as medical waste, is any waste that is generated during the diagnosis, treatment, or immunization of humans or animals. This waste can include a wide range of materials, such as needles, syringes, blood, body parts, and microbiological waste. Due to the potential health risks associated with biomedical waste, it must be handled and disposed of in a safe and environmentally friendly manner.
The Role of biomedical waste incinerators
Biomedical waste incinerators are designed to safely and efficiently dispose of medical waste through the process of combustion. These incinerators operate at high temperatures, typically between 800 and 1,200 degrees Celsius, which is hot enough to destroy pathogens and reduce waste to ash. This process not only reduces the volume of waste but also eliminates the risk of contamination and the spread of infectious diseases.
In addition to reducing the volume of waste, biomedical waste incinerators also help prevent pollution and environmental damage. When medical waste is burned in an incinerator, harmful chemicals and toxins are neutralized, preventing them from seeping into the soil or contaminating water sources. This is especially important in regions where landfills are already overburdened, as burning medical waste can help alleviate pressure on these facilities.

The Benefits of biomedical waste incinerators
There are several benefits to using biomedical waste incinerators for the disposal of medical waste. One of the primary advantages is the reduction in waste volume, which can help decrease the amount of space needed for storage and disposal. This is particularly important in densely populated areas where land is limited and expensive.
Another benefit of biomedical waste incinerators is the elimination of harmful pathogens and toxins. By burning medical waste at high temperatures, these incinerators are able to destroy harmful bacteria and viruses, reducing the risk of infection and contamination. This is especially important in healthcare settings where the spread of infectious diseases must be minimized.
Furthermore, biomedical waste incinerators can help healthcare facilities comply with regulations and standards regarding the safe disposal of medical waste. By using these incinerators, facilities can ensure that they are following proper protocols and protecting public health. This can also help prevent fines and legal action that may result from improper waste disposal practices.
